Opening Of Regular Season To Be Pushed Back

Major League Baseball announced Monday that the start of the 2020 regular season will be pushed back even further following Sunday’s recommendations by the Centers for Disease Control (CDC).

Derrick Goold Helps Organization CPR Certification After Saving Colleague's Life At Busch Stadium

The St. Louis Post Dispatch writer who saved a man's life by performing CPR on him at Busch Stadium last fall partnered with the American Heart Association and the St. Louis Fire Department to get more people CPR certified.

Thanksgiving Extra Special To Mike Flanary Who Nearly Died At Busch Stadium

St. Louis video photographer Mike Flanary has said the only reason he still is alive is because of the help of bystanders, led by Post-Dispatch baseball writer Derrick Goold, and medical personnel after he collapsed while suffering a heart ailment in September at Busch Stadium.

Derrick Goold Helps Save Man's Life At Busch Stadium

Before he chronicled the Cardinals’ first division title clinching since 2015, Post-Dispatch baseball writer Derrick Goold helped save a man’s life Sunday at Busch Stadium.

St. Louis Viewers, Media Hung In There For Epic Marathon

The game wore on. And on. Midnight became 1 o’clock in the morning. Then it was 2. And 3. Finally, at nearly 3:35 a.m. Wednesday in St. Louis, the Cardinals-Diamondbacks marathon in Phoenix that had begun 6 hours 53 minutes earlier was over. Arizona scored in the bottom of the 19th inning to win 3-2.
